1. A mechanical draft modular air cooled condenser comprising:

  • a succession of a first condenser bundle panel, a second condenser bundle panel, a third condenser bundle panel, and a fourth condenser bundle panel;

    a first condenser pair including;

    the first condenser bundle panel having a first top end and a first bottom end;

    a first condensate header connected to the first bottom end;

    the second condenser bundle panel consecutive to the first condenser bundle panel, the second condenser bundle panel having a second top end and a second bottom end; and

    a second condensate header connected to the second bottom end, the first bottom end of the first condenser bundle panel and the second bottom end of the second condenser bundle converging toward each other, the first condensate header and the second condensate header separated by a first distance;

    a second condenser pair including;

    the third condenser bundle panel consecutive to the second condenser bundle panel, the third condenser bundle panel having a third top end and a third bottom end;

    a third condensate header connected to the third bottom end, the third condensate header and the first condensate header separated by a second distance, the second distance greater than the first distance;

    the fourth condenser bundle panel consecutive to the third condenser bundle panel, the fourth condenser bundle panel having a fourth top end and a fourth bottom end; and

    a fourth condensate header connected to the fourth bottom end, the third bottom end of the third condenser bundle panel and the fourth bottom end of the fourth condenser bundle converging toward each other, the fourth condensate header and the third condensate header separated by the first distance, the fourth condensate header and the second condensate header separated by the second distance;

    a fan positioned to create a draft to flow over the first condenser bundle panel, over the second condenser bundle panel, over the third condenser bundle panel, and over the fourth condenser bundle panel; and

    a support frame that supports the first, second, third, and fourth condenser bundle panels.
